The Legacy of James Bond
Sean Connery
Connery set the Bond standard (1962-1971) with charm, wit, and action.
George Lazenby
Lazenby starred in On Her Majesty’s Secret Service (1969) but only played Bond once.
Roger Moore
Moore (1973-1985) brought humor and elegance, making Bond more playful.
Timothy Dalton
Dalton (1987-1989) gave Bond a darker, intense, and more realistic edge.
Pierce Brosnan
Brosnan (1995-2002) balanced action and sophistication, redefining Bond.
Daniel Craig
Craig (2006-2021) made Bond raw, emotional, and grounded in realism.
Other Notable Bond Portrayals
Barry Nelson played Bond on TV, while David Niven starred in a parody.
